Secured and Unsecured
MyData Portal has two parts, one unsecured and the other secured. The unsecured portion allows anyone using a computer on the district's network to view summary data for the district and schools. These data are said to be unsecured because they do not identify individual students or teachers.
For example, anyone can view the percentage of students who passed the TAKS in the district or in a school. The unsecured portion of MyData Portal also has demographic information (under Enrollment Data) showing the number of students in the district and in a school by gender, ethnicity, limited English proficiency (LEP) status, etc. Explore the home page simply by following the different links and familiarizing yourself with the information. As with any new web site, the more you use it, the easier it becomes to find the information you need.
Data about individual students and teachers are stored in the secured portion of MyData Portal. It is said to be secured because only users with password-protected accounts can access the data. Teachers, principals, or counselors have user accounts because they have a legitimate and ongoing educational purpose for examining individual demographic data and test scores; these data are pivotal for them to make educational decisions affecting students.
